SDOT’s Capital Projects Division has a great opportunity for detail‑oriented and collaborative Senior Project Managers (Strategic Advisor
1)
to work as part of the Capital Projects’ Project Management team managing some of SDOT’s more complex projects directly and support other project managers in delivering a variety of transportation capital projects including paving, transit, sidewalk, multimodal, bridge, and structural projects. This position will work with our team of dedicated transportation engineering and project delivery professionals to ensure that project elements are implemented and delivered successfully.

  • Manage full life cycle of assigned portfolio, including scope, schedule, and budget for multiple concurrent and complex SDOT projects with budgets ranging from $10 M to over $100 M.
  • Maintain Clarity PPM database to document project budgets, spending, risk elements, and project schedules.
  • Provide grant reporting and monitors compliance of federally funded projects.
  • Coordinate with other SDOT divisions, City agencies, and external stakeholders to proactively solve project issues.
  • Regularly engage with and provide reports and presentations to leadership, elected officials, and community members.
  • Prepare and help execute inter‑departmental and inter‑agency agreements leading to successful project delivery.
  • Assist with the preparation, selection, and negotiation of consultant contracts.
  • Support project teams of 100 people or more, including SDOT matrixed staff, inter‑departmental staff, consultants, and interagency partners.
  • Support department goals in promoting diversity and social justice in keeping with the City’s Race and Social Justice Initiative.
  • Provide implementation support and training for Capital Projects Division special projects, new technology, best practices, and/or new processes.
  • Provide updates at monthly meetings with project controls staff on topics such as project risk management, cost estimating, project budgeting and schedules, quality control/quality assurance, and lessons learned.
  • Serve as Primary Point of Contact on assigned Capital Projects, guiding a team of technicians, peers, superiors, and subject matter experts.
